1. Karat technical interview (pretty much as many questions as you can get through, first one prob LC easy and then LC mediums after that) 2. Recruiter Phone Screen 3. Technical Interview 1 (2 coding questions, first one didn't really feel LC but the second one was prob LC med) 4. Technical Interview 2 + Behavioral (not really a LC-style question, behavioral is based on their principles + product) 5. Reference Check (1-2 manager references)
The process for me was extremely fast (~1 week). I appreciated how responsive my recruiter was and how quickly I was moved forward with next steps after each round. All the interviewers were really friendly and I had a lot of time to ask questions after the technical problems. I would assume there might be some variance for the Karat interview since it's outsourced, but I was pretty lucky that my Karat interviewer was super nice as well. They gave a pretty flexible offer deadline and were very accommodating about extensions.
